Shortest Path Analysis, within cryptocurrency and derivatives, represents a computational procedure designed to identify the most efficient route for executing a trade or managing risk across a complex network of exchanges, liquidity pools, and financial instruments. Its application extends beyond simple price discovery, encompassing considerations of transaction costs, slippage, and counterparty risk inherent in decentralized finance. The core principle involves graph theory, where nodes represent states—such as asset holdings or option positions—and edges signify possible transitions, weighted by associated costs or probabilities. Consequently, optimal strategies derived from this analysis aim to minimize exposure to adverse market movements while maximizing potential returns, particularly crucial in volatile crypto markets.
